Output e8ddd3a62a5a745a0560e55241251de453ab05907b07f6d1657a58cbe87c14d4:20

value
79411453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05140bb175a7d94edaf5368e5a027d6dbc0543d1 OP_EQUAL
address
M8N1dBpYunkztq9T8dxxcFXT3ZSr9XQZe4
transaction
e8ddd3a62a5a745a0560e55241251de453ab05907b07f6d1657a58cbe87c14d4
spent
true